Forming Supervisor

Ardagh GroupHenderson, NV
2dOnsite

About The Position

The Forming Supervisor supervises hourly union employees for one shift of the forming department. This role ensures the shift is engaged in the manufacturing of glass containers to ensure customer requirements are met.
